Confucius discusses the principle of shu, and he shares four more qualities you should embody if you want to be a force for good in the world.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Keep reading to learn the Confucian way of morality.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<!--more-->\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-confucius-on-virtue\">Confucius on Virtue<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>According to Confucius, virtue is guided principally by <em>shu<\/em>. So, what is <em>shu<\/em>? This Chinese word essentially means <strong>don\u2019t do to others what you wouldn&#8217;t want to be done to you.&nbsp;<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>(Shortform note: <em>Shu <\/em>seems to be a fairly straightforward concept, but there\u2019s debate about how to translate the word itself. Some scholars say that it means <a href=\"https:\/\/iep.utm.edu\/confucius\/#:~:text=%E2%80%9CSelf%2Dreflection%E2%80%9D%20(shu)%20is%20explained%20by%20Confucius%20as%20a%20negatively%2Dphrased%20version%20of%20the%20%E2%80%9CGolden%20Rule%E2%80%9D%3A%20%E2%80%9CWhat%20you%20do%20not%20desire%20for%20yourself%2C%20do%20not%20do%20to%20others.%E2%80%9D%20(15.24)%20When%20one%20reflects%20upon%20oneself%2C%20one%20realizes%20the%20necessity%20of%20concern%20for%20others.\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">self-reflection<\/a>\u2014you imagine yourself in others\u2019 positions, \u201creflecting\u201d yourself onto them and thereby developing empathy. Others translate it as <a href=\"https:\/\/www.alliancemagazine.org\/analysis\/traditions-of-giving-in-confucianism\/#:~:text=In%20this%20connection%20mention%20should%20be%20made%20of%20another%20important%20Confucian%20idea%2C%20shu%20(%E2%80%98reciprocity%E2%80%99).\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">reciprocity<\/a>, saying that <em>shu <\/em>refers to the relationship between yourself and others; if you treat others well then they will treat you well, and, if you treat them poorly, then they\u2019ll treat you poorly.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.webpages.uidaho.edu\/ngier\/308\/308analects.htm#:~:text=reciprocity%2C%20loyalty%2C%20deference%2C%20altruistic%2C%20doing%20your%20best%20and%20respecting%20others\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Other translations<\/a> of <em>shu <\/em>include respect, deference, and altruism.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>However, while <em>shu <\/em>is a good foundation for <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/psychology-morality\/\">moral behavior<\/a>, Confucius adds that causing no harm isn\u2019t enough to be a truly good person. Rather, a good person is someone who\u2019s respectful, honest, hardworking, and kind. In other words, <strong>to be a good person, you must do your best to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/hub\/society-culture\/how-to-make-the-world-a-better-place\/\">make the world a better place<\/a>.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>We\u2019ll highlight four of Confucius\u2019s insights on <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/how-to-be-a-good-human-being\/\">how to be a good person<\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Hard Work<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Confucius conveys that working hard is part of being a good person. He adds that putting forth your best effort has personal benefits, so there are reasons for even a selfish person to do so. Hard work will bring you satisfaction\u2014namely, <strong>if you <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/always-do-your-best\/\">always do your best<\/a>, then you\u2019ll be satisfied with your efforts regardless of their outcomes.<\/strong> On the other hand, if you don\u2019t give your best effort, you\u2019ll feel unsettled and guilty because you\u2019ll know that you could have done more.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Confucius also advises you to adjust your life so that you <em>can <\/em>do your best.<\/strong> This could mean changing where you live, where you work, who you spend time with, or anything else\u2014if something gets in the way of you living well and doing your best work, it\u2019s not worth holding on to.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Honesty<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Confucius teaches that honesty is another key part of proper conduct\u2014a good person must be trustworthy.&nbsp;When Confucius discusses honesty, he doesn\u2019t just mean not telling lies. <strong>You should also try to be honest in your thoughts. <\/strong>In other words, avoid unfair biases; strive to see people, things, and situations as they are instead of as you expect (or want) them to be.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Honesty also means being frank about your skills and knowledge: Don\u2019t inflate your abilities, but don\u2019t <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/selling-yourself-short\/\">sell yourself short<\/a>, either. <strong>In short, know your own worth and be honest about it.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>To avoid accidentally telling lies, Confucius recommends not talking about your plans or goals because you\u2019ll be ashamed if your actions don\u2019t live up to your words. Instead, <strong>take action first, and only talk about it afterward.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Finally, Confucius says that an honest person must avoid hypocrisy. He suggests that you <strong>ask yourself at the end of each day whether you gave any advice that you don\u2019t personally follow.<\/strong> If so, change either your actions or your teachings so that you can avoid such hypocrisy in the future.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Altruism<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Since Confucius defines a good person as someone who strives to improve the world, he believes that good people must be altruistic: They act to help others rather than for personal gain. Confucius describes this using the Chinese word <em>ren<\/em>, translated as \u201chumaneness\u201d or \u201chumanity.\u201d For him, <em>ren<\/em> means always striving to live<strong> <\/strong>up to the moral standards he sets throughout the <em>Analects<\/em>, no matter what. He says that good people would rather die than compromise their morals.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Confucius also offers two concrete suggestions for living altruistically. First, should you find yourself in an unfair or immoral culture, it\u2019s acceptable to <em>say <\/em>whatever you must to protect yourself\u2014but under no circumstances should you <em>do <\/em>anything immoral or cruel. Have the courage to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/living-by-your-values\/\">live by your values<\/a> at any cost.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Second, frugality is another important aspect of altruism. Since altruism is the opposite of selfishness, altruistic people try not to take more than they need. <strong>They\u2019re happy to live modestly, with a small home and simple food. <\/strong>Confucius says obsessing over material goods when you already have enough to live on is a waste of energy that would be better spent helping others.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Effortless Action<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Confucius teaches that, for good people, proper conduct seems effortless\u2014they simply know the right thing to do and do it. For that reason, he considers effortless action to be proof of good moral character. To describe this concept, he uses the term <em><a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/what-is-wuwei\/\">wuwei<\/a><\/em>, a Chinese word that can mean <em>action without effort <\/em>or simply <em>inaction.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Effortless action seems to go against the earlier principle of hard work, but that\u2019s because<strong> the work of wuwei is internal and therefore invisible to others.<\/strong> In other words, instead of struggling to do the right thing (external, visible effort), you struggle to turn yourself into the kind of person who <em>always <\/em>does the right thing (internal, invisible effort).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>One of the main benefits of effortless action is that it keeps you focused on <a href=\"https:\/\/www.shortform.com\/blog\/control-what-you-can-control\/\">things you can control<\/a>: <\/strong>namely, the internal, invisible effort of shaping your actions and qualifications.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>What is shu?
